Where your envelopes addressed with caligraphy? If so this can cause a delay. The sorting machine does not always read them correctly.
If a guest has not received the invite just be prepared to either provide a new one or let them know all the details. Unless you need a head count way ahead I suggest checking in with people 10 days before the deadline and making sure they have recieved invites. That way if they didn't reeive them they have tome to make arrangements and make a descision before your rsvp deadline.
